Characteristics of Hilo Omega

Hilo Omega is known for its high-quality blend of fibers, which typically include acrylic and cotton. This combination results in a soft, durable yarn that is easy to work with. The yarn comes in various thicknesses, making it suitable for a wide range of projects, from delicate shawls to sturdy garments. Its extensive color palette allows crafters to express their creativity and add a personal touch to their creations.

Recommended Projects

This versatile yarn is ideal for various knitting projects. Beginners may find it perfect for scarves and simple hats, while more advanced knitters can experiment with intricate patterns and textures. Hilo Omega’s smooth finish makes it an excellent choice for colorwork, allowing for clean transitions between shades. Additionally, it’s great for home decor items like blankets and cushions, adding warmth and style to any space.
Tips for Using Hilo Omega
To maximize your experience with Hilo Omega, consider using the appropriate needle size to match the yarn thickness. Always check your gauge before starting a project to ensure the right fit and drape. If you're working on larger items, it’s advisable to purchase enough yarn from the same dye lot to avoid color discrepancies. Lastly, enjoy the process!
